Key Switches and Noise Levels
The Corsair K65 Plus offers various switch options, including Cherry MX Red, Brown, and Blue. Users choosing Red or Brown switches generally find the keyboard suitable for long sessions due to their quieter operation and lighter actuation force. Blue switches, while popular among typists, tend to be louder and may become distracting during extended use in shared spaces.
Impact of Switch Choice on Comfort
Switch selection significantly influences comfort. Lighter switches reduce finger fatigue, making the K65 Plus more suitable for all-day use. Conversely, heavier switches may cause strain after several hours of continuous typing or gaming.

Ergonomic Tips for All-day Use
- Use wrist rests to reduce strain.
- Take regular breaks to stretch fingers and hands.
- Adjust keyboard height to align with your elbows.
- Choose switches that require less force.
